Allegation: Staff do not provide activities to residents in care
It was alleged that residents are not provided activity while in care. On 4/26/23, LPA Brown conducted interviews with Administrator and staff S1-S4, staff and administrator stated residents have activities daily at the facility and have no concerns. LPA reviewed the activity schedule and staff roster that listed activity director and did not see a discrepancy. During today’s visit LPA observed residents having activities in Assisted living and Memory Care area. Based on investigation the above allegation is unsubstantiated.
Allegation: Staff does not ensure that the facility remains free of odors from incontinence
It was alleged that the facility Memory Care unit (MCU) has an overwhelming smell. On 4/26/23, Interview conducted with the Administrator stated had no complaints or concerns regarding smell in the facility. LPA Brown conducted interviews and 3 out of 4 staff stated had no concern with the smell in the facility and had any concerns. LPA reviewed the laundry and housekeeping schedule and did not see a discrepancy. During today’s visit LPA tour resident’s bedrooms and common areas and did not observe any odors while touring the facility. Based on investigation the above allegation is unsubstantiated.
Allegation: Resident grooming needs are not met
It was alleged that the resident in the facility is not well groomed. On 4/26/23, Interview conducted with the Administrator stated residents grooming needs are being met and had no complaints or concerns. LPA Brown conducted interviews with 3 out 4 staff stated residents hygiene needs are being met. 3 out of 4 staff stated they have a schedule to ensure residents hygiene needs are being met. LPA reviewed care staff schedule and observed residents in the facility to be cleaned and groomed. Based on investigation the above allegation is unsubstantiated.
Based on interviews conducted, the preponderance of evidence standard has not been met. Although the allegation(s) may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of evidence to prove the alleged violation did or did not occur, therefore the allegation(s) is unsubstantiated.
